Helen Lea

Born and raised in Kansas City, Missouri, Helen Lea earned her undergraduate degree in art history at the Smith College. After graduation, she studied Italian and classical painting in Perugia, Italy. Returning to Kansas City she spent a year working as an artist for Hallmark Cards. She then moved to New York where she worked at the Frick Museum.

Lea returned to Kansas City in 1961, married and started a family while continuing to paint and study. She received a degree in Fine Arts from the Kansas City Art Institute in 1970.

Lea’s work has been shown at numerous exhibitions and her paintings are found in both individual and corporate collections worldwide.
